Prepare to unwind on the pristine beaches of Punta Cana at the luxurious Bahia Principe Grand Turquesa. This ultimate resort promises an unforgettable experience filled with bliss. Indulge in delectable dining at a https://aoifesmcv967922.blogpostie.com/54476903/escape-yourself-in-bahia-principe-grand-turquesa-your-all-inclusive-paradise-awaits